Shelbyville has an obesity rate of 40.2%, which is 4.1pp above the national average. The depression rate is 25.9%, 2.4pp above the national average. About 10.7% of adults lack health insurance. 78.2% of residents had an annual checkup in the past year. There are 5 hospitals nearby. 5 offer emergency services. The average CMS quality rating is 2.8 out of 5.
